1. 75ee30f Drop support for GHC 6.10. by John Millikin · 6 years ago
  2. 0c3bb97 Export 'SignalHandler' so the docs can link to it. by John Millikin · 6 years ago
  3. ab4e80f Bump version to 0.10.7. by John Millikin · 6 years ago
  4. df71981 Add eavesdrop=true to the filters in examples/dbus-monitor.hs. by John Millikin · 6 years ago
  5. 04d5380 Add the 'addMatch' and 'removeMatch' functions for signal handling. by John Millikin · 6 years ago
  6. 4686210 Adds functionality to remove an exported ObjectPath. by Stefan Haller · 6 years ago
  7. d63b784 Remove maximum dependency version on text and unix. by John Millikin · 6 years ago
  8. ae98a78 Allow building against cereal-0.4 by John Millikin · 6 years ago
  9. 3ff2635 Update source-repository locations. by John Millikin · 6 years ago
  10. 4a660a7 Remove upper version limit for the dependency on network. by John Millikin · 7 years ago
  11. b044ebb Bump version to 0.10.3. by John Millikin · 7 years ago
  12. 3f927c1 Fix error where failing to listen on a UNIX socket would leak a file descriptor. by John Millikin · 7 years ago
  13. cb1717d Fix an error where failing to connect a UNIX client socket would leak a by John Millikin · 7 years ago
  14. ab9ec77 Bump version to 0.10.2. by John Millikin · 7 years ago
  15. 5b8106d Add a client option for running the main loop in a special function. This by John Millikin · 7 years ago
  16. abb3787 Provide a more informative error message when parsing a message header fails by John Millikin · 7 years ago
  17. b356545 Handle a lost connection in the socket transport by detecting EOF and by John Millikin · 7 years ago
  18. 736c027 Bump dependency limit for vector. by John Millikin · 7 years ago
  19. c9a242e Fix up test dependencies. by John Millikin · 7 years ago
  20. 2f7efc8 Remove maximum dependency limit on bytestring. by John Millikin · 7 years ago
  21. 55a75a6 Remove non-ASCII characters from the Cabal description, because it makes by John Millikin · 7 years ago
  22. 315b493 Fix build of the "introspect" example. by John Millikin · 7 years ago
  23. c60ffc4 Normalize capitalization of 'Unix' and 'XML' in APIs and documentation. by John Millikin · 7 years ago
  24. 3379c49 Remove the 'PropertyAccess' type, changing it to boolean fields of 'Property'. by John Millikin · 7 years ago
  25. ca91238 Add documentation for name types. by John Millikin · 7 years ago
  26. a4e38f1 Add documentation for message types, and non-native containers. by John Millikin · 7 years ago
  27. ec56b36 Rename the "list names" example to list-names.hs by John Millikin · 7 years ago
  28. acfc97d Add a description to the Cabal file. by John Millikin · 7 years ago
  29. bb6d50f Update examples/introspect.hs for abstract introspection types. by John Millikin · 7 years ago
  30. 6f195e6 Complete branch coverage for introspection tests. by John Millikin · 7 years ago
  31. b46758e Rename toXML and fromXML. by John Millikin · 7 years ago
  32. 98650f9 Make introspection types abstract. by John Millikin · 7 years ago
  33. aa1a657 Avoid converting to Text while marshaling or unmarshaling object paths. by John Millikin · 7 years ago
  34. 46bcfaf Add some more tests for introspection, for full branch coverage. by John Millikin · 7 years ago
  35. 55f89e4 Removed unused function 'maybeParseText'. by John Millikin · 7 years ago
  36. d49b921 Remove 'MessageFlag' and 'methodCallFlags'. Flags are now inlined into the by John Millikin · 7 years ago
  37. a718bb1 Add documentation to the heterogenous container types. by John Millikin · 7 years ago
  38. e311fc0 Add documentation for address functions. by John Millikin · 7 years ago
  39. 9d9714d Rename 'marshalMessage' and 'unmarshalMessage' before exporting. by John Millikin · 7 years ago
  40. 6b2ab05 Add docs for 'serialValue' and 'nextSerial'. Better wrapping in 'nextSerial'. by John Millikin · 7 years ago
  41. 64e717e Add module documentation to DBus.Client. Fix a typo in docs for 'listen'. by John Millikin · 7 years ago
  42. 236d73c Move docs for 'ClientError' lower in the output page. Better docs for 'export'. by John Millikin · 7 years ago
  43. d0e8190 Keep 'methodCallSender' set when sending calls to the bus. by John Millikin · 7 years ago
  44. ff10c91 Add documentation on the behavior of matching sender names when listening by John Millikin · 7 years ago
  45. 07599ec Cross-link documentation for 'method' and 'autoMethod'. by John Millikin · 7 years ago
  46. 1d12cdd Remove object proxies, as the new way to construct MethodCall values makes by John Millikin · 7 years ago
  47. bdc39e7 Remove client options for timeouts and reconnection. by John Millikin · 7 years ago
  48. 42e50d9 Update examples for changes to the API. by John Millikin · 7 years ago
  49. e97e406 Re-enable recording information about received unknown messages. Export by John Millikin · 7 years ago
  50. de8d9f1 Make name request flags abstract. Add a hidden constructor to replies so by John Millikin · 7 years ago
  51. 39c5d68 Remove UnknownMessage. If an unknown type of message is received, it will by John Millikin · 7 years ago
  52. 2e4441a Remove unused import from serialization tests. by John Millikin · 7 years ago
  53. a597fbd Allow users to modify the serials in method errors and method returns. by John Millikin · 7 years ago
  54. 1b272df Make Signal abstract. by John Millikin · 7 years ago
  55. 196fd8b Make MethodCall abstract. by John Millikin · 7 years ago
  56. 0b826fb Make MethodReturn and MethodError abstract. by John Millikin · 7 years ago
  57. e3ad37e Make UnknownMessage abstract. by John Millikin · 7 years ago
  58. deaf5bf Rename Flag to MessageFlag, and make it abstract. by John Millikin · 7 years ago
  59. 43a413e Add an explicit export list to DBus.Message. by John Millikin · 7 years ago
  60. 01ff6b2 Fix formatting in DBus.Client example. by John Millikin · 7 years ago
  61. 383ab7b Change 'DBus.Client.method' to take the full MethodCall message as its by John Millikin · 7 years ago
  62. ccb127a When listening for signals, restrict the match rule to type='signal'. by John Millikin · 7 years ago
  63. 1c1af10 Add more documentation to DBus.Client. by John Millikin · 7 years ago
  64. 0f5b771 Merge 'AutoSignature' and 'AutoReply' classes. by John Millikin · 7 years ago
  65. 2afa4b0 Clean up a few uses of [[ return $ Foo bar ]] by John Millikin · 7 years ago
  66. cdeafa7 Remove unused MemberSignal constructor for exported members. by John Millikin · 7 years ago
  67. b4813df Use plain strings for introspection data, they're easier to work with than Text. by John Millikin · 7 years ago
  68. b51cd21 Add tests for generating introspection data from automatic method exports. by John Millikin · 7 years ago
  69. a0dc3a7 Change 'showType' to use "Dict" instead of "Map". by John Millikin · 7 years ago
  70. fd7f791 Update examples to build with new module names and API. by John Millikin · 7 years ago
  71. b08469d Make 'transportGet' for SocketTransport conform to the documentation, by by John Millikin · 7 years ago
  72. 9762df5 Add prefixes to name management replies. by John Millikin · 7 years ago
  73. 3ad8ebe Store method call flags as a plain list. Make 'messageFlags' and by John Millikin · 7 years ago
  74. 573f49b Fix the order of iface/methodName in MethodCall. by John Millikin · 7 years ago
  75. 9cc713b Make 'ioT' and 'valueT' not top-level definitions. by John Millikin · 7 years ago
  76. 1aaaf3f Add tests for 'autoMethod'. by John Millikin · 7 years ago
  77. c7502b9 Update check for failed method calls due to a disconnected client. by John Millikin · 7 years ago
  78. 1825423 Add tests for DBus.Client 'call', 'callNoReply', and 'listen' functions. by John Millikin · 7 years ago
  79. 09f60cd Add tests for 'requestName' and 'releaseName'. by John Millikin · 7 years ago
  80. b8a52c2 Add tests for failures in the client connection functions. Fix incorrect by John Millikin · 7 years ago
  81. e159d9a Add an MVar finalizer in 'call', allowing canceled calls to have their by John Millikin · 7 years ago
  82. d3ac490 Remove OverloadedStrings pragmas from DBus.Socket and DBus.Wire. by John Millikin · 7 years ago
  83. 559b1ca Add a test for failing to bind to a TCP port. by John Millikin · 7 years ago
  84. e9381e5 Add tests for some ways XML parsing can fail. by John Millikin · 7 years ago
  85. 36f090c Remove the 'DBus.Constants' module. by John Millikin · 7 years ago
  86. 9051cda Add tests for 'methodErrorMessage'. by John Millikin · 7 years ago
  87. 88d9738 Fix test build for abstract Reply. by John Millikin · 7 years ago
  88. b3953f4 Add 'marshalErrorMessage' and 'unmarshalErrorMessage' functions. by John Millikin · 7 years ago
  89. e6e490b Make DBus.Client.Reply abstract. by John Millikin · 7 years ago
  90. 62dbade Properly validate dictionary and structure types in 'signature'. by John Millikin · 7 years ago
  91. 0cdfd14 Make 'methodErrorMessage' return String. by John Millikin · 7 years ago
  92. a6c5b45 Make 'parseSignature' take a String as input. The ByteString signature parser by John Millikin · 7 years ago
  93. d47b7a1 Remove unneeded OverloadedStrings pragmas. by John Millikin · 7 years ago
  94. 2ef8505 Use String for conversion to and from the string-like types. by John Millikin · 7 years ago
  95. 0337fc9 Rename 'signatureText' to 'formatSignature', and make it return String. by John Millikin · 7 years ago
  96. ee574d6 Make address-related functions use String instead of ByteString. by John Millikin · 7 years ago
  97. 6461108 Add 'DBus.Client.callNoReply'. by John Millikin · 7 years ago
  98. 498b2f2 Export 'DBus.Client.call_'. by John Millikin · 7 years ago
  99. a9975e5 Remove remaining HTML entities from the Haddock docs. by John Millikin · 7 years ago
  100. 213f04e Clean up some HLint warnings. by John Millikin · 7 years ago